The Quintessential Charm of the Cotswolds: England's Timelessly Enchanting Countryside

The Cotswolds is a picturesque area in England, known for its charming villages, rolling hills, and ancient stone buildings. The region, located in southwest England, attracts tourists with its beautiful landscapes and traditional English architecture. The article discusses the natural beauty of the Cotswolds, the historical significance of the area, and the popularity of the region as a tourist destination. Overall, it emphasizes the Cotswolds as a must-visit place for those seeking an authentic English countryside experience.